Output 75a784c896cd46a47a431f9606c19dd5a06161365e092aef282bbdeea98c0ea0:0

value
10569025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f43c318582732e934cbb792cf1cccb98971be1b OP_EQUAL
address
38v8UtdKsSRQDtsm9ZfzEUtwuZJwosjgzu
transaction
75a784c896cd46a47a431f9606c19dd5a06161365e092aef282bbdeea98c0ea0
confirmations
526834
spent
true